Transaction 836862de3f32b93b3b7d3e00b506fcc3b2959d7f9355fceff7c8cf7e157dc295

96 Input
1 Outputs
  • 836862de3f32b93b3b7d3e00b506fcc3b2959d7f9355fceff7c8cf7e157dc295:0
  • value  51714084
    address  1Fnz3RMkaKP4ZYXRVBrak5h8is28ad5nEs